#9e572d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e572d is composed of 62% red, 34.1%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 22.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 39.8%. #9e572d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ae5a with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#9e572d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e572d has RGB values of R:158, G:87,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.72,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10377005.

Shades and Tints of #9e572d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e572d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676564 is the less saturated color, while #c54d06 is the most saturated one.
